Xbox One Games with Gold July 2016 free games list changes this week

 Xbox Newswire

Since it is the middle of the month, the list of free games in the Games with Gold program of the Xbox One changes.

The current list, announced earlier this month, is again a mix of genres for the Xbox Games with Gold program. Two triple-A titles for the Xbox 360, "Rainbow Six Vegas 2" and "Tron Evolution," are part of long-standing franchises. Meanwhile, "Tumblestone" is a local multiplayer puzzle game with a number of game modes for both single- and multiplayer battles. For the hardcore RPG fan, "The Banner Saga 2" is an award-winning sequel, story-based role-playing title.

However, as with previous Games with Gold lists, the download schedules will change this weekend. Players will have until Friday this week to download "Tom Clancy's Rainbow Six: Vegas 2," since it is only available for the Xbox 360 from July 1 to 15. In addition, a title from last month's Games with Gold list, "The Crew," is also available for download until July 15.

Meanwhile, "Tumblestone" will be available for download on the Xbox One starting July 16, and can be added to the games library for free until August 15. Another triple-A title for the Xbox 360, "Tron Evolution," will also be added to the Games with Gold July 2016 list from July 16 to 31.

It should also be noted that both "Tom Clancy's Rainbow Six: Vegas 2" and "Tron Evolution" can also be downloaded for the Xbox One, since the two classic titles are playable on the current-gen console via the backwards compatibility program.

Since it is still the middle of the month, there are still no speculations on what Xbox plans to bring to the Games with Gold August 2016 list. However, it is expected that the list will be another mix of triple-A titles and classic games, with all games playable on the current-gen Microsoft console.
